Smooth Rubber Flooring for Practical Indoor Areas
This smooth black rubber floor matting provides a compact 1m x 1m flooring solution with a substantial 4mm thickness and approximately 1m² of coverage. It is designed for use over suitable surfaces including concrete and can be used across a broad range of practical environments.
The supplied applications include gymnasiums, garages, workshops, school corridors, stages, exhibition centres, activity centres, recreation grounds, amusement parks and retirement homes. Its plain black appearance and smooth surface create a straightforward contemporary finish that can integrate easily into different interior layouts.
4mm Thickness Provides a Defined Floor Layer
At 4mm thick, the matting offers more material depth than very thin decorative rubber flooring while maintaining a relatively controlled finished floor height. This can be useful around thresholds, adjoining surfaces and other areas where excessive floor build-up may be undesirable.
The product is also specified as shock absorbing and comfortable underfoot, making the rubber construction relevant to areas that experience regular walking, exercise or general activity.
Although shock absorption is listed as a product feature, no specific impact test rating is supplied. Buyers planning particularly demanding equipment or repeated heavy-impact use should therefore assess whether a thicker specialist flooring product would be more appropriate.
Smooth Non-Slip Surface with a Solid Black Finish
The visible floor surface is described as smooth with a solid black pattern. This creates a cleaner appearance than checker, coin, diamond or raised stud rubber flooring and may suit areas where a more understated surface is preferred.
Non-slip performance is specifically listed among the product features. The material is also described as antistatic, sound absorbing and easy to clean, providing several practical characteristics for regularly used indoor areas.
No independent slip-resistance, acoustic or antistatic test classifications are supplied, so these should be treated as listed product features rather than independently verified performance ratings.
1m x 1m Format Provides 1m² Coverage
The matting measures 1m x 1m and provides a stated coverage of approximately one square metre. This makes initial quantity planning straightforward because each full piece corresponds to a nominal 1m² section of flooring.
The product is supplied individually, with one item included per pack. This allows buyers to calculate the number of pieces required according to the total floor area.
Where the installation includes walls, corners, equipment bases or irregular boundaries, additional material may be required to accommodate trimming and normal fitting wastage.
Peel-and-Stick Installation Over Suitable Subfloors
The supplied specifications identify the installation method as peel and stick, while concrete is specifically listed as a suitable subfloor. The existing surface should be appropriately prepared so the flooring can sit consistently across the finished area.
The product information also states that no acclimation period is required. This can simplify preparation compared with flooring materials that need to remain in the installation environment for an extended period before fitting.
Surface conditions should still be checked carefully before installation. A clean, dry and reasonably even base can help achieve a more consistent result, particularly with relatively thin 4mm rubber flooring.
Suitable for Gyms, Workshops and Activity Spaces
The wide range of listed applications makes this matting suitable for both practical work areas and active indoor environments. Gymnasiums and activity centres may benefit from its shock-absorbing and sound-absorbing characteristics, while garages and workshops can use the rubber surface as a dedicated floor covering.
School corridors, stages, exhibition centres and retirement homes are also included among the stated applications. The smooth black finish keeps the appearance neutral, allowing it to work across environments with different interior styles.
Care is straightforward, with the supplied instructions recommending wiping the surface with a damp cloth. Routine cleaning can help maintain both the appearance and everyday usability of the flooring.
Frequently Asked Questions
What size is this rubber floor matting?
The matting measures 1m x 1m and provides approximately one square metre of stated floor coverage. This makes quantity calculations straightforward for smaller areas or installations using several individual pieces.
How thick is the rubber flooring?
The flooring is 4mm thick, with the wear layer also stated as 4mm. This provides a relatively substantial rubber surface while keeping the overall floor profile lower than thick gym or impact mats.
Is the surface smooth or patterned?
The floor surface is specified as smooth with a solid black appearance. It does not use raised coin, checker or stud patterns, giving the installed flooring a cleaner and more understated finish.
Is this rubber matting non-slip?
Yes. Non-slip performance is specifically listed among the product features. No independent slip-resistance test classification is supplied, so the feature should not be interpreted as a particular certified rating.
Does the flooring absorb shock and sound?
Shock absorbing and sound absorbing are both listed product characteristics. These features can be useful in active environments, although no specific impact or acoustic performance figures are provided in the supplied details.
Can this flooring be installed over concrete?
Yes. Concrete is specifically identified as a suitable subfloor. The underlying surface should still be clean, dry and reasonably even before installation to help achieve a more consistent finished floor.
How is this rubber flooring installed?
The supplied installation method is peel and stick. Careful positioning and suitable floor preparation are important because the flooring should be aligned correctly before it is fully secured to the substrate.
Is this matting suitable for gyms and workshops?
Yes. Gymnasiums, garages and workshops are all listed among the suitable areas. The flooring is also specified for school corridors, stages, exhibition centres and several other activity spaces.
How should the rubber surface be cleaned?
The stated care instruction is to wipe the flooring with a damp cloth. Regular cleaning helps remove dust and surface marks while maintaining the appearance of the smooth black rubber finish.
Does the flooring need acclimation before installation?
No acclimation is required according to the supplied product specifications. The installation area and subfloor should still be prepared correctly before fitting to support a consistent finished surface.
